Tight warehouse capacity is driving record lease signings and intermodal is emerging as a clear cost-saving opportunity for shippers, according to Q2 earnings reports from J.B. Hunt and Prologis covered by FreightWaves.
Key Takeaways from Q2 Earnings
FreightWaves reported that the Q2 earnings reports from Prologis and J.B. Hunt reveal critical shifts in the freight market. Tight warehouse capacity is driving record lease signings, and the intermodal sector is presenting massive opportunities for shippers looking to cut costs. The analysis also breaks down diverging rate trends between truckload and intermodal, showing where "the smart money is moving" and what it means for supply chain strategy.
Impact on Shippers and Operators
The findings are directly relevant to freight forwarders, logistics managers, and supply chain directors. With warehouse capacity tight and lease signings at record levels, operators face higher storage costs and limited availability. In response, shifting volumes to intermodal rail can help shippers reduce transportation expenses as intermodal rates become more favorable compared to truckload. The rate divergence suggests that carriers and shippers should re-evaluate their modal mix to capture cost savings.
